Claimant: U.S. Department of Health and Human Services
Claim: A Do No Harm database proves more than 5,500 minors in the U.S. had “sex change surgeries” from 2019 to 2023.
Rating: BLATANT LIE
Explanation: The database cited by HHS included many procedures that were unrelated to gender-affirming surgery, inflating the total. Peer-reviewed research indicates that gender-affirming surgeries among minors are rare and primarily involve chest procedures performed on older teenagers.
